<%@ page language="java" contentType="text/html; charset=UTF-8" pageEncoding="UTF-8"%>
<html>
<head>
<meta http-equiv="Content-Type" content="text/html; charset=utf-8">
<title>全选</title>
<script type="text/javascript" src="jquery/jquery-1.4.3.min.js" language="javascript"></script>
<script type="text/javascript" language="javascript">
$( function() {
$('.checkAll').live('change',function() { //元素绑定一个简单的click事件
$('.cb-element').attr('checked', $(this).is(':checked' )?'checked':''); //匹配给定的属性是某个特定值的元素
$(this).next().text($(this).is(':checked')?'全选':'反选'); //用于筛选的表达式(条件表达式)
});
$('.cb-element').live( 'change', function() {
$('.cb-element').length == $('.cb-element:checked').length ? $('.checkAll').attr('checked','checked').next().text('全选'):$('.checkAll').attr('checked','').next().text('反选');
});
});
</script>
</head>
<body>
<div class="controls">
<span><input type="checkbox" class="checkAll"/><b><label id="lbl">全选/反选</label></b></span>
</div>
<div class="elements">
<span><input type="checkbox" class="cb-element"/>Checkbox1</span>
<span><input type="checkbox" class="cb-element"/>Checkbox2</span>
<span><input type="checkbox" class="cb-element"/>Checkbox3</span>
<span><input type="checkbox" class="cb-element"/>Checkbox4</span>
</div>
</body>
</html>
分享到:
相关推荐
### Flex DataGrid Checkbox 全选/反选知识点详解 #### 一、概述 Flex DataGrid 控件是Adobe Flex框架中的一个重要组成部分,它提供了一个灵活的方式来展示数据列表,并且支持多种功能,如排序、分组、筛选等。在...
而在这个特定的场景中,我们需要实现一个增强的功能:在`DataGridView`的列头添加一个`CheckBox`,通过这个`CheckBox`可以实现所有行中对应复选框的全选或反选操作。这个功能在数据管理界面中十分常见,例如在批量...
以下是三种实现Checkbox全选和反选的方法,以及它们的JavaScript和Java实现细节。 ### 方法一:使用`checked`属性 **JavaScript实现**: 在JavaScript中,可以通过获取全选按钮的`checked`属性来控制所有复选框的...
在高级控件如DataGridView中,通过结合Checkbox可以实现全选和反选功能,为用户提供便捷的操作方式。这个经典例子将深入探讨如何在Web应用中实现这一功能。 1. **Checkbox基本概念** Checkbox是HTML中的一个表单...
综上所述,这个“android ListView中的checkBox全选和反选Demo”主要展示了如何在ListView中集成CheckBox,实现列表项的全选和反选功能,以及如何优化Adapter以提高性能。理解并掌握这些知识点对于Android开发者来说...
"Android CheckBox全选反选"这个话题主要涉及如何在ListView中实现CheckBox的选择与反选择操作,包括全选和反选的功能。ListView是Android系统提供的一种列表视图,它可以显示大量数据并允许用户进行交互。下面我们...
在Windows应用程序开发...总之,`DataGridView`表头添加`CheckBox`实现全选反选涉及了控件创建、事件处理、数据绑定以及用户交互等多个方面。理解这些知识点可以帮助开发者更有效地构建功能丰富的数据查看和编辑界面。
实现技术: 无刷新 验证指定字符 验证数字 验证邮箱 无刷新下拉菜单三级联动 CheckBox全选/反选/删除 等等.. 程序收集了本人在ASP.NET开发应用中会经常用到的轻量级的AJAX小例子,程序里面很多地方做了注释,通俗易懂...
页面上通过一个checkbox实现全选与反选
本教程将详细介绍如何在WPF中实现CheckBox的全选和反选功能。 首先,我们需要理解CheckBox的基本用法。在XAML中,我们可以创建一个CheckBox并为其设置文本和初始状态: ```xml <CheckBox Content="全选" x:Name=...
在本示例中,我们将探讨如何实现GridView中的全选/反选功能,通过复选框(checkbox)来实现这一操作。这个示例特别适合于那些需要用户批量处理数据的应用场景。 首先,`Default.aspx`是用户界面的主要部分,它包含...
在JavaScript编程中,"全选/反选"是常见的用户交互功能,常见于表格、列表等数据展示场景,允许用户一次性选择或取消选择所有项目。这个功能在网页表单、电子表格应用、在线文档编辑器等领域都有广泛的应用。在本...
js原生,checkbox全选,反选,选特定的值。jq会更简单。。初学时候比用的
资源名称:JS实现checkbox的全选和反选资源截图: 资源太大,传百度网盘了,链接在附件中,有需要的同学自取。
**一、Checkbox全选与反选** 1. **Checkbox基本概念**:Checkbox是HTML中的一种表单元素,用于用户输入布尔值(即“选中”或“未选中”)。通过设置`checked`属性,可以默认选中一个复选框。 2. **全选功能**:在...
### jQuery与JavaScript操作Checkbox全选反选 #### 一、引言 在Web开发中,Checkbox(复选框)是一种非常常见的用户界面元素,用于收集用户的多选输入。尤其是在表单设计时,Checkbox的全选与反选功能极大地方便了...
asp.net(C#),DataList控件里嵌入CheckBox,实现全选、反选以及删除功能。
在前端开发中,checkbox全选、反选、取消的操作是常见的功能需求,通常用于实现批量操作。在此过程中,开发者可能会遇到一些问题,例如页面在执行这些操作时出现异常。这里会详细探讨相关知识点,包括checkbox的基本...
在标题"jQuery实现复选框全选/反选demo源码"中,我们关注的核心知识点是利用jQuery实现复选框的全选和反选功能。这个功能在许多网页应用中都非常实用,比如在表格数据筛选、表单多选等场景。通过简单的jQuery代码,...
在“checkbox全选与反选”的场景中,我们通常会遇到行全选、列全选以及相应的联动效果。下面将详细阐述这个主题的知识点。 一、全选与反选的基本原理 全选功能是通过一个主复选框控制所有子复选框的状态,当主复选...